Tezos Smart Rollups: Nâng cao khả năng mở rộng Blockchain mà không làm giảm tính phi tập trung

Tóm tắt: Bài viết này sẽ thảo luận về cách Tezos Smart Rollups nâng cao khả năng mở rộng của blockchain (Tezos: XTZ) mà không làm giảm tính phi tập trung. Nó sẽ tập trung vào các tính năng chính của Tezos Smart Rollups, bao gồm Data Availability Layer (DAL), cơ chế đồng thuận Tenderbake, Sequencer phi tập trung và các ứng dụng tiềm năng. Ngoài ra, bài viết sẽ cung cấp hướng dẫn chi tiết về cách cài đặt và sử dụng Tezos Smart Rollups.

Tezos Smart Rollups là gì?

Tezos đã là một đối thủ cạnh tranh trong cuộc đua blockchain Layer 1 thay thế, ban đầu khẳng định vị thế của mình với lời hứa về quản trị trên chuỗi và tự sửa đổi để tránh các hard fork gây hại cho các blockchain khác. Ban đầu được thiết kế như một hệ thống đơn khối, Tezos (XTZ) yêu cầu mọi node phải sao chép tất cả hoạt động, một mô hình mà mặc dù mạnh mẽ trong việc bảo mật mạng phi tập trung, nhưng lại đặt ra những thách thức đáng kể về khả năng mở rộng. Khi hoạt động mạng gia tăng, nhu cầu về sức mạnh tính toán và băng thông cũng tăng theo, đẩy giới hạn của tính bền vững và có khả năng gây nguy hiểm cho sự tập trung, nơi mà chỉ những nhà khai thác có tài nguyên đáng kể mới có thể tham gia hiệu quả.

Tezos Smart Rollups

Để giải quyết những vấn đề này trong khi vẫn duy trì tính phi tập trung, Tezos đã chuyển từ kiến ​​trúc đơn khối sang kiến ​​trúc modular. Cách tiếp cận “modular” này nhằm mục đích cung cấp những cải thiện hiệu suất đáng kể đồng thời thừa kế đầy đủ tính bảo mật và khả năng chống kiểm duyệt của Layer 1. Cách tiếp cận này có thể nâng cao hiệu suất tổng thể của Tezos và cho phép Tezos đạt được sự cân bằng tinh tế giữa những lợi ích của cả hệ thống đơn khối và modular.

Ghi chú: Tezos Smart Rollups là một ví dụ về “optimistic rollups”, tức là chúng giả định rằng các giao dịch được xử lý một cách chính xác cho đến khi có bằng chứng cho thấy điều ngược lại.

Tìm hiểu đầy đủ thông tin về Tezos Smart Rollups tại link sau đây: https://tezos.com/developers/smart-rollups/

Tezos Smart Rollups cải thiện khả năng mở rộng như thế nào?

Tezos Smart Rollups đang triển khai một loạt nâng cấp sẽ cải thiện khả năng mở rộng mà không làm giảm tính phi tập trung.

Data Availability Layer (DAL)

Để đạt được khả năng mở rộng theo chiều dọc và ngang, dữ liệu phải có sẵn khi cần mà không làm giảm tính phi tập trung và duy trì tốc độ đồng thời. Để đạt được điều này, Tezos Smart Rollups tích hợp DAL hoặc Data Availability Layer. DAL cung cấp đảm bảo rằng dữ liệu sẽ có sẵn bằng cách dựa vào sự đồng thuận của các baker, những người chỉ đăng một phần dữ liệu. Thông qua việc sử dụng mã hóa ERASURE và cam kết KZG, dữ liệu có thể được khôi phục nhanh chóng.

Đồng thời, DAL sẽ được tối ưu hóa hơn nữa bằng cách phân mảnh khả năng có sẵn dữ liệu, trong đó các baker sẽ lưu trữ và giữ dữ liệu dựa trên cổ phần của họ và làm cho chúng có sẵn khi cần. Do đó, điều này cải thiện đáng kể thông lượng mà không đặt ra bất kỳ câu hỏi nào về tính phi tập trung. Thông qua thực hành này, nếu một DAL đơn giản tăng thông lượng lên 10-100 lần khi Tezos Smart-rollups tích hợp phân mảnh khả năng có sẵn dữ liệu, thì đầu ra sẽ là 1.000-10.000 lần vì không gian khối của blockchain Tezos sẽ không đóng vai trò là một trở ngại trong việc lưu trữ và xử lý dữ liệu.

Cơ chế đồng thuận Tenderbake

Tezos Smart-rollups sẽ thay thế cơ chế đồng thuận cũ bằng một cơ chế mới để cải thiện thời gian khối. Kết quả là, các Dapp sẽ nhanh hơn nhiều trên Tezos Smart Rollups. Để đạt được điều này, Tenderbake Consensus sẽ thay thế Emmy. Tenderbake sẽ giới thiệu tính xác định cuối cùng, trong đó xem xét một khối là cuối cùng nếu hai khối ngay trước khối mục tiêu. Vì vậy, việc phân nhánh không xảy ra và mạng hoạt động liên tục bất chấp tải trọng khổng lồ được tạo ra.

Sequencer phi tập trung

Hệ sinh thái smart roll-up cũng sẽ giới thiệu các sequencer phi tập trung cho các rollup chính tắc. Các sequencer phi tập trung này sẽ giảm độ trễ của sự đồng thuận roll-up thông qua việc đặt hàng giao dịch công bằng bằng cách sử dụng TSS hoặc Threshold Signature Scheme và mở rộng quy mô cao hơn mà không bị sa lầy vào các cuộc tấn công MEV.

Ngoài ra, Tezos Smart Rollups vẫn đang trong giai đoạn phát triển, và có thể sẽ có thêm nhiều cải tiến trong tương lai.

Các ứng dụng tiềm năng của Tezos Smart Rollups

Tezos Smart Rollups đơn giản hóa đáng kể cách xử lý lượng lớn dữ liệu trên blockchain, làm cho việc quản lý các hoạt động phức tạp trở nên khả thi, nếu không sẽ quá cồng kềnh và tốn kém trên nền tảng Layer 1.

Ứng dụng tiềm năngLợi ích
Tăng thông lượng giao dịchCho phép thông lượng giao dịch mỗi giây cao hơn, giải quyết vấn đề mở rộng của L1 truyền thống.
Giảm chi phíTránh phí giao dịch và lưu trữ quá mức, khiến blockchain hiệu quả về chi phí hơn.
Tích hợp dữ liệu bên ngoàiTương tác với các nguồn dữ liệu bên ngoài, hỗ trợ các ứng dụng cần dữ liệu thời gian thực.
Sự linh hoạt của môi trường thực thiTương thích với nhiều môi trường thực thi khác nhau, tạo điều kiện thuận lợi cho quá trình chuyển đổi giữa các nền tảng blockchain.
  • Tăng thông lượng giao dịch: Bằng cách cho phép thông lượng giao dịch mỗi giây cao hơn, các smart rollups này giải quyết các vấn đề về khả năng mở rộng cốt lõi vốn có trong các thiết lập L1 truyền thống.
  • Giảm chi phí: Một trong những lợi ích thực tế hơn của Smart Rollups là khả năng giảm một số khoản phí nhất định. Người dùng có thể tránh được phí giao dịch và phí lưu trữ quá mức, thường tích lũy trên chuỗi chính. Hiệu quả kinh tế này hỗ trợ việc áp dụng rộng rãi các ứng dụng blockchain bằng cách khiến chúng trở nên hiệu quả về chi phí hơn.
  • Tích hợp dữ liệu bên ngoài: Smart Roll Ups có khả năng tương tác với các nguồn dữ liệu bên ngoài theo cách mà các hợp đồng thông minh tiêu chuẩn không thể. Tính năng này đặc biệt có giá trị đối với các ứng dụng dựa trên tích hợp dữ liệu thời gian thực từ bên ngoài blockchain.
  • Sự linh hoạt của môi trường thực thi: Ngoài ra, sự linh hoạt của Smart Rollups mở rộng đến khả năng tương thích của chúng với nhiều môi trường thực thi khác nhau. Ví dụ, việc triển khai Etherlink trong Smart Rollups cho phép các ứng dụng dựa trên EVM chạy trên Tezos, tạo điều kiện thuận lợi cho quá trình chuyển đổi suôn sẻ hơn cho các nhà phát triển làm việc trên các nền tảng blockchain.

Smart Rollups có thể giúp Tezos cạnh tranh với các blockchain khác như Ethereum, những blockchain đang gặp khó khăn trong việc mở rộng quy mô. Tezos Smart Rollups có tiềm năng thay đổi cách mọi người sử dụng blockchain và làm cho blockchain trở nên hữu ích hơn cho nhiều ứng dụng.

Nhận xét

Tezos Smart Rollups là một bước tiến đáng chú ý trong việc nâng cao khả năng mở rộng của blockchain Tezos. Công nghệ này có tiềm năng cách mạng hóa cách mọi người sử dụng blockchain và làm cho blockchain trở nên hữu ích hơn cho nhiều ứng dụng. Theo nhận định của Click Digital, việc kết hợp các tính năng như Data Availability Layer (DAL) và cơ chế đồng thuận Tenderbake cho phép Tezos Smart Rollups xử lý khối lượng giao dịch lớn hơn và nhanh hơn, đồng thời duy trì tính phi tập trung và bảo mật. Sự nâng cấp này hứa hẹn sẽ thúc đẩy sự phát triển của Tezos trong cuộc cạnh tranh blockchain đang diễn ra gay gắt (cạnh tranh với các blockchain khác như Ethereum, Solana, Aptos,…), đồng thời mở ra những khả năng mới cho các nhà phát triển và người dùng.

Hướng dẫn cài đặt và sử dụng Tezos Smart Rollups

Để sử dụng Tezos Smart Rollups, bạn cần cài đặt và cấu hình một node Tezos với phiên bản Octez v17.2 hoặc cao hơn. Dưới đây là các bước chi tiết:

  1. Cài đặt Octez: Tải xuống và cài đặt Octez v17.2 hoặc cao hơn từ trang web chính thức của Tezos.
  2. Cấu hình node: Cấu hình node Tezos để sử dụng mạng Nairobi testnet hoặc Ghostnet. Bạn có thể tham khảo tài liệu chính thức của Tezos để biết thêm thông tin.
  3. Cài đặt Smart Rollup Daemons: Cài đặt Smart Rollup Daemons từ kho lưu trữ Tezos.
  4. Cấu hình ví: Tạo một ví Tezos và nhận 10.000 test ꜩ từ Nairobi faucet.
  5. Chọn WASM Kernel: Tải xuống một WASM Kernel từ kho lưu trữ Tezos.
  6. Tạo Rollup: Sử dụng lệnh octez-client để tạo một smart rollup.
  7. Cấu hình Rollup Daemons: Cấu hình Smart Rollup Daemons để sử dụng smart rollup mới tạo.
  8. Khởi chạy Rollup Daemons: Khởi chạy Smart Rollup Daemons để bắt đầu sử dụng smart rollup.

Lưu ý: Hướng dẫn cài đặt và sử dụng Tezos Smart Rollups này chỉ là một bản tóm tắt cơ bản. Bạn cần tham khảo tài liệu chính thức của Tezos để biết thêm thông tin chi tiết và hướng dẫn đầy đủ: https://spotlight.tezos.com/setting-up-a-tezos-smart-rollup-in-5-steps

Kết luận

Tezos Smart Rollups cung cấp một giải pháp khả thi cho vấn đề mở rộng của blockchain. Chúng có khả năng nâng cao hiệu suất của mạng Tezos một cách đáng kể mà không làm giảm tính phi tập trung. Với các tính năng mới như DAL và Tenderbake Consensus, Tezos Smart Rollups mở ra những khả năng mới cho các nhà phát triển và người dùng, đưa Tezos tiến gần hơn đến mục tiêu trở thành nền tảng blockchain mạnh mẽ và hiệu quả cho tương lai.

[+++]

Lưu ý: Bài viết chỉ cung cấp góc nhìn và không phải là lời khuyên đầu tư.

Đọc các Sách chính thống về Blockchain, Bitcoin, Crypto

Combo 5 sách Bitcoin
Combo 5 sách Bitcoin
Để nhận ưu đãi giảm phí giao dịch, đăng ký tài khoản tại các sàn giao dịch sau:

👉 Nếu bạn cần Dịch vụ quảng cáo crypto, liên hệ Click Digital ngay. 🤗

Cảm ơn bạn đã đọc. Chúc bạn đầu tư thành công. 🤗

Giới thiệu token Saigon (SGN):

  • Đầu tư vào các công ty quảng cáo blockchain hàng đầu bằng cách MUA token Saigon (SGN) trên Pancakeswap: https://t.co/KJbk71cFe8/ (đừng lo lắng về tính thanh khoản, hãy trở thành nhà đầu tư sớm)
  • Được hỗ trợ bởi Công ty Click Digital
  • Nâng cao kiến thức về blockchain và crypto
  • Lợi nhuận sẽ dùng để mua lại SGN hoặc đốt bớt nguồn cung SGN để đẩy giá SGN tăng.
  • Địa chỉ token trên mạng BSC: 0xa29c5da6673fd66e96065f44da94e351a3e2af65
  • Twitter X: https://twitter.com/SaigonSGN135/
  • Staking SGN: http://135web.net/

Rate this post

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*